使用AdvancedListPane在OWL中进行过滤

2020-08-19 03:45发布

点击此处---> 群内免费提供SAP练习系统(在群公告中)加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)专家们, 在我们的自定义B...

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


专家们,

在我们的自定义BO-OWL视图中,我们希望根据用户相关值进行过滤-因此用户仅看到添加了他作为"审阅者"的交易。

我定义了一个额外的查询-但是您可以在哪里设置依赖关系? 在登录的用户上? 我在机会中可以看到类似的解决方案。

通过Context.GetCurrentIdentityUUID()。content找到了该用户,该用户等于BO中的某些值-因此它一定不会那么困难。

每个有用的答案都很好。

亲切的问候,

Jeroen Cosijnse

Gonogo.jpg (13.0 kB)
6条回答
宇峰Kouji
2020-08-19 04:42

您好Jeroen Cosijnse,

在SAP Cloud Applications Studio中定义一个库(ABSL脚本),该库将返回当前登录的用户,

在UI设计器中打开OWL,
转到"控制器"选项卡,

选择查询并选择默认设置,

选择用户查询参数,

在所选查询参数的"选择选项"下,选择 在"转换"字段下进行字段转换,请选择第一步中定义的库。

感谢Pradeep。

一周热门 更多>